Sylvester Angus Hall was born 24 February 1896 in Elba, Cassia County, Idaho to Cumorah Angus Hall (1867-1918) and Elna Helene Christine Christensen (1877-1955) and died 4 December 1972 Evanston, Uinta County, Wyoming of unspecified causes. He married Emma Maude Sparks (1899-1991) 15 April 1934 in Ogden, Weber County, Utah.

Biography

Sylvester Angus Hall served in overseas with the American Expeditionary Force in World War I. The day he returned home was the same day his father died from the Spanish Flu epidemic. After the war he worked in various coal mines in Western Wyoming and in later years would take his son Robert to visit some of those sites.

Sylvester worked on Hoover Dam construction project from 1931 up to his marriage in in 1934. Being a staunch democrat he refused to acknowledge it's republican name and always referred to it as "Boulder Dam". After returning to Wyoming he got employed by the Union Pacific Railroad and operated steam trains from the Evanston, Wyoming roundhouse and operated on the route from Green River, Wyoming to Ogden, Utah until reaching retirement age. He made his family home at 1500 Center Street, just a couple blocks up the hill from the Evanston Roundhouse.

His hobbies included fishing in the wooded hills of Western Wyoming.

He died from complications from emphysema which was first instigated from his many years working in the coal mines.
